France, May 13 -- President Emmanuel Macron is expected on Tuesday night to unfurl his vision for the last two years of his presidency including the possibility of a referendum on certain issues during a two-hour interview on national television.

The TF1 special called "Emmanuel Macron - the challenges for France" will be anchored by Gilles Bouleau who will be joined by union leaders who will grill Macron on his record.

The president will also answer questions sent in by ordinary citizens.

"Surrounded by more than 100 square meters of screens, the president will be addressed by figures from civil society, both on set and via video," TF1 added in a statement on Tuesday.
